University of Tasmania – School of Natural Sciences

University of Tasmania

The University of Tasmania’s space capabilities focus on satellite tracking, space situational awareness, and deep space communication. Through its array of six radio telescopes and collaboration with national and international partners, it supports missions involving satellite reentry, orbital debris monitoring, and radio science and planetary exploration. The university also contributes to research and development in space science, offering advanced infrastructure and expertise in sensor technology, data analysis, and space operations. Its strategic location and technical assets make it a valuable contributor to both commercial and governmental space initiatives, particularly in the Southern Hemisphere.
